TELUX™ LED
Description The TELUX™ series is a clear, non diffused LED for high end applications where supreme luminous flux is required. It is designed in an industry standard 7.62 mm square package utilizing highly developed In Ga N technology. The supreme heat dissipation of TELUX™ allows applications at high ambient temperatures. Features Lead-free device
Utilizing In Ga N technology
Applications
High luminous flux
Supreme heat dissipation: Rth JP is 90 K/W Exterior lighting High operating temperature: Tj + 100 °C Interior lighting Packed in tubes for automatic insertion Dashboard illumination Luminous flux and color categorized for each tube Replaces incandescent lamps
Small mechanical tolerances allow precise usage of external reflectors or lightguides ESD-withstand voltage: > 1 k V acc. to MIL STD 883 D, Method 3015.7
